Taegyuni.github.io

screenshot of Taegyuni.github.io
jekyll

Taegyuni.github.io

태균이의 블로그

Product Analysis: Chirpy Jekyll Theme

Overview:

Chirpy Jekyll Theme is a minimal, responsive, and feature-rich Jekyll theme specifically designed for technical writing. It offers a range of features and customization options to create a visually appealing and user-friendly website.

Features:

  • Dark / Light Theme Mode: Allows users to switch between dark and light themes based on their preference.
  • Localized UI language: Supports multiple languages for the user interface, making it accessible to a wider audience.
  • Pinned Posts: Gives the option to feature important or popular posts at the top of the page.
  • Hierarchical Categories: Organizes content into a hierarchical structure, enabling easy navigation and browsing.
  • Trending Tags: Highlights popular or trending tags to showcase the most relevant and engaging content.
  • Table of Contents: Creates an automatically generated table of contents for each post, enhancing readability.
  • Last Modified Date of Posts: Displays the date when a post was last modified, providing users with up-to-date information.
  • Syntax Highlighting: Highlights code snippets and syntax for improved readability and understanding.
  • Mathematical Expressions: Supports mathematical expressions using LaTeX syntax for scientific or technical documentation.
  • Mermaid Diagram & Flowchart: Enables the creation of interactive diagrams and flowcharts for visual representation of complex ideas.
  • Dark / Light Mode Images: Provides different image styles based on the chosen dark or light theme.
  • Embed Videos: Allows embedding videos from various platforms to enhance content with multimedia elements.
  • Disqus / Utterances / Giscus Comments: Provides integration with popular commenting systems for user engagement and feedback.
  • Search: Includes a search functionality to quickly find relevant content within the website.
  • Atom Feeds: Supports Atom feeds for subscribers to stay updated with new posts or content changes.
  • Google Analytics: Integrates with Google Analytics to track website traffic and user engagement.
  • Page Views Reporting: Provides statistics and reports on page views to analyze website performance.
  • SEO & Performance Optimization: Optimizes the website for search engines and improves performance for better user experience.

Installation:

To install the Chirpy Jekyll Theme, follow these steps:

  1. Install Jekyll and RubyGems on your system.
  2. Clone the Chirpy Jekyll Theme repository from GitHub.
  3. Install the required gems by running bundle install in the theme directory.
  4. Configure the theme settings by editing the _config.yml file.
  5. Start the Jekyll development server by running bundle exec jekyll serve.
  6. Open your web browser and visit http://localhost:4000 to preview the website.

Summary:

Chirpy Jekyll Theme is a versatile and feature-rich Jekyll theme ideal for technical writing. With its extensive range of features, including dark/light theme modes, localized UI language, hierarchical categories, and various integrations, this theme offers a customizable and user-friendly experience. Whether you're creating a personal blog or a professional technical documentation website, Chirpy Jekyll Theme provides the necessary tools and optimizations to make your content visually appealing and easily accessible.

jekyll
Jekyll

Jekyll is a static site generator written in Ruby that allows you to create simple, fast, and secure websites without the need for a database.

rollup
Rollup

RollupJS is a popular and efficient JavaScript module bundler that takes the code from multiple modules and packages them into a single optimized file, minimizing the overall size of the application and improving its performance.

Stylelint

Stylelint is a modern linter for CSS that helps you avoid errors and enforce consistent styling conventions. It provides rules for detecting errors and warnings, and can be configured to match your specific project's requirements.